API Development with Apigee (- X) on Google Cloud




API Development with Apigee (- X) on Google Cloud

The course starts by explaining the API and its life cycle as per APIGEE.  The APIGEE provisioning is explained and configured showing all the steps. Once this is created we can build API proxies and API products.  Components of the APIGEE are explained and the relationship between these.

Different kinds of policies are used while creating the API proxies. The proxy creation starts with the basic proxies to understand the apigee environemnt.  The proxy creation is explained both in Classic and the new Proxy Editor.

After understanding the environment,  the course continues to explain and create different proxies with with complex policies. 

These are the different kinds of API proxies created

Calling SOAP webservices

Calling Java Class and utilize the functionality of Java.

Service callout policy is used call external endpoints in between the service to get the needed information for the proxy.

Flow callout policy implemented to call shared flows so that same functionality implementation can be reused.

JavaScript policy is implemented to demonstrate the functionality of JavaScript and how to interact with Flow variables in API proxy and JavaScript code.

Different kinds of security handling is explained and implemented  using policies like Oauth, Basic Authentication, XML Thret Protection, JSON Threat Protection, JSON Web Token(JWT), JSON Web Signature (JWS), API key, and HMAC.

The API creation to API deployment steps are explained to understand the system completely. How to use components like Developer portal, Apps, and Product are explained with examples.


Apigee provisioning, Service callout, Java callout, Oauth, HMAC, JWT, JWS, XML /JSON threat protection, SOAP, OAS

Url: View Details

What you will learn
  • Apigee provisioning, Create API Proxy and API products
  • Applying security to API proxy - API key, OAUTH 2.0, Basic Auth
  • Flow callout, Service callout, Java callout, JavaScript policy implmentation

Rating: 4.38462

Level: All Levels

Duration: 11.5 hours

Instructor: Prashant Naik


Courses By:   0-9  A  B  C  D  E  F  G  H  I  J  K  L  M  N  O  P  Q  R  S  T  U  V  W  X  Y  Z 

About US

The display of third-party trademarks and trade names on this site does not necessarily indicate any affiliation or endorsement of coursescompany.com.


© 2021 coursescompany.com. All rights reserved.
View Sitemap